(ULH) advanced 1.94% to $16.29 in recent trading, moving closer to its identified resistance level of $17.10. The stock remains above support at $15.48, maintaining a neutral-to-bullish short-term posture as it tests the upper end of its trading range.

Volume patterns during this session have been consistent with recent averages, indicating normal trading activity rather than a sudden spike in interest. The move higher appears to be driven by general sector momentum rather than company-specific news, as the broader transportation and logistics group has seen modest gains. ULH’s price action reflects a continuation of the recovery from its recent low near $15.00, with buyers stepping in at support levels. The company’s financial profile – a niche logistics provider with exposure to industrial and automotive end markets – may be benefiting from steady demand in those sectors despite macroeconomic headwinds. Key drivers behind today’s advance likely include short-covering and technical buying as the stock approaches resistance, as well as a possible positive read-through from peer earnings or industry data. However, without a clear catalyst, the move could be categorized as a routine bounce within a range-bound pattern. Traders will be watching whether the volume increases on any breakout attempt to confirm conviction. A sustained move above this area could open the path toward the next potential resistance around $18.50. On the downside, support at $15.48 remains critical; a break below that would shift the bias negative and likely test the $14.80 area.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is in the mid-50s to low-60s range, suggesting neither overbought nor oversold conditions, but with room for further upside before reaching overbought territory. Moving average analysis shows the price is currently trading above its 50-day moving average but still below the 200-day moving average, indicating a mixed trend. The 50-day average is roughly in the $15.80–$16.00 range, providing near-term support. Volume on recent up days has been moderate, not yet signaling strong institutional accumulation. The price action over the past few weeks has formed a series of higher lows, a constructive pattern that could support further gains if resistance is breached. Looking ahead, ULH could potentially challenge the $17.10 resistance in the coming sessions, but a clean breakout may require a catalyst such as positive earnings guidance or a sector-wide rally. If the stock fails to clear resistance and retreats, it may consolidate between $15.48 and $17.10, giving traders a range-bound opportunity. Factors that could influence future performance include quarterly earnings results (due next month), changes in fuel costs, and macroeconomic trends affecting freight demand. A bearish scenario could emerge if broader economic concerns lead to a decline in industrial production, while a bullish scenario might materialize if the company reports better-than-expected margins or wins new contracts. Investors should monitor volume closely on any move above $17.10 to assess the strength of the breakout. Without a clear fundamental trigger, the stock may continue to oscillate within its current boundaries. Any decisive move beyond the resistance or below support would provide a clearer directional signal.
